Tile grout repair services involve fixing the gaps and lines between tiles to restore their appearance and functionality. Over time, grout can become cracked, stained, or loose due to regular wear and tear, moisture exposure, or shifting foundations. Repairing grout typically includes removing damaged sections, cleaning out old material, and applying fresh grout to ensure the tiles stay securely in place and look their best. This process helps prevent further damage and maintains the overall aesthetic of tiled surfaces in both residential and commercial properties.
Many common problems can be addressed through grout repair. Cracked or crumbling grout can lead to water seepage, which may cause underlying issues like mold growth or structural damage, especially in areas prone to moisture such as bathrooms, kitchens, or laundry rooms. Discolored or stained grout can detract from the visual appeal of tiled surfaces, making spaces look older or poorly maintained. Additionally, loose grout can cause tiles to shift or become loose, increasing the risk of tiles falling out or breaking. Repairing grout helps resolve these issues, improving both the appearance and durability of tiled areas.

The overview below groups typical Tile Grout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Port Huron, MI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or grout repairs in Port Huron, MI, range from $150 to $300. Many routine fixes, such as regrouting a small section, tend to fall within this range. Fewer projects reach higher amounts unless additional work is needed.
Moderate Restoration - For mid-sized grout repair projects, local contractors often charge between $300 and $600. This includes larger sections or multiple areas needing attention, which are common for homeowners seeking a thorough refresh.
Large-Scale Repairs - Extensive grout restoration or repairs on multiple surfaces can cost between $600 and $1,200. These projects are less frequent and typically involve significant work to restore or replace grout in larger areas.
Full Tile and Grout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of tile and grout can exceed $2,000, with larger, more complex jobs reaching $5,000 or more. Such projects are less common and usually involve extensive renovation or upgrading efforts.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es grout to deteriorate in tile installations? Grout can deteriorate over time due to moisture exposure, mold growth, or frequent cleaning, which can lead to cracks and discoloration.
How can I tell if my tile grout need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, gaps, discoloration, or loose tiles, indicating that grout may require professional attention.
What types of grout repair services are available? Local contractors typically offer cleaning, regrouting, sealing, and crack repair to restore the appearance and integrity of tile grout.
Is grout repair necessary for maintaining tile durability? Yes, repairing damaged grout helps prevent water infiltration and tile damage, supporting the longevity of the tile surface.
How do professionals handle grout color matching during repair? Experienced service providers often use color-matching techniques or grout dyes to ensure repairs blend seamlessly with existing grout.
